Secret negotiations’ in Brighton on way to sell Seagulls player for €20-22m
![](https://sportzonenews.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/06/stu.webp)
Brighton and Hove Albion will hold ‘secret negotiations’ with VfB Stuttgart over Deniz Undav as the two sides look to wrap up a permanent deal for him.
That’s according to Sport BILD, who say the striker is on his way to getting his wish of remaining with the German side.
Undav has been on loan with Stuttgart this season after a disappointing first year at Brighton and has been one of the stars of the show, forming a deadly partnership with Serhou Guirassy and firing the German side into the Champions League.
He’s keen to make the deal permanent and has publically urged the two teams to do a deal, but Brighton’s asking price of €20m has long been a problem point for Stuttgart.
Sport BILD insist that remains the case today, stating the price is actually €20-22m plus €5m in wages, a ‘big package’ for the Germans to pay out.
Thus, they want to talk to Brighton to try and work something out and so a trip has been planned for Stuttgart officials.
They will travel to Brighton in order to negotiate the exact details of the deal, preferring to meet face to face to do so.
Whether they can find an agreement remains to be seen, with the Seagulls holding firm to a price that Stuttgart have long insisted they can’t afford even with Champions League money behind them.
